Output 660e3b74abc46afb3037c8513d2c36074a39a5d279af0ee1739267aeddcb4206:6

value
5993
script pubkey
OP_0 OP_PUSHBYTES_20 895b1b91f02d1ee396c0952048a95d52d02c076c
address
tb1q39d3hy0s950w89kqj5sy322a2tgzcpmv84rkq0
transaction
660e3b74abc46afb3037c8513d2c36074a39a5d279af0ee1739267aeddcb4206